Business Performance Improvement

An Executive Briefing
Download as PDF
      
        
        
Description:The world is a tougher place today! We all have to deliver more with less! Budgets are being cut - yet outputs are expected to improve.

Successful organisations today need to ensure that their business operations and projects are aligned properly with strategic organisational goals. And the world is changing more rapidly today than ever before!

How do we organise our business processes and projects for optimum effectiveness in this scenario? The answer is - it isn't easy - but the returns are huge in terms of business value for those who can get it right.

This briefing will present delegates with an understanding of the current ‘state-of-the-art’ business processes improvement methodologies. We will show you how to approach Business Process Improvement in order to guarantee a successful outcome and make a meaningful impact on the performance of the organisation.
Suitable for:This briefing is suitable for senior managers, staff managers, senior staff members and anyone involved in strategic planning and/or business process improvement activities.
Duration:Half Day
Briefing Objectives:At the end of this briefing, participants will understand how to :

- Align the organisation to meet the strategic goals.
- Measure the effectiveness of the organisation.
- Implement and manage change.
- Maintain and improve the organisation’s performance.
- Deal with conflicting resource requirements.
- Create an effective organisation structure.
- Use BPI Tools to energise people and deliver success.
Benefits:Improve the ability of your organisation to meet its goals and objectives.
Make sure teams and individuals are working on the ‘right’ projects.
Eliminate wasted time and effort in the business processes.
Topics Included:Setting a Strategic Direction for the Organisation

Aligning individuals and teams with the overall direction

Dealing with conflicting requirements for time and resources

Aligning the organisation structure

KPI’s and measuring effectiveness

Managing change

Business Process Improvement Tools

Operational Excellence Tools

Lean Six Sigma applied to Business Process Improvement
